This low-frequency usage typically reduces wear on the drivetrain components, engine internals, and braking systems. However, long periods of standing can sometimes lead to the degradation of rubber-based components and fluid chemistry rather than mileage-related wear. While the MOT history shows no mechanical or structural failures, a physical inspection should focus on components affected by low-mileage storage. A buyer must check for perished or cracked rubber hoses, fork seals, and tyres, which can perish from age regardless of remaining tread depth. The deteriorated registration plate noted in 2022 and 2023 is a minor cosmetic issue that should have been addressed to ensure legal compliance. Given the low mileage, verifying the state of the brake fluid and checking for brake caliper corrosion is essential to ensure the bike has not suffered from internal oxidation.
